In the Window
When I look into the window
I see a girl at a table
She has a furious expression
Tears run down her cheeks freely
She doesn’t care who sees them
She doesn’t seem to care at all
A look inside her
I can see her clearly
So much emotion
Built up big
But it won’t come out, not easily
That explains the furry
As I look from the window,
This is what I see
I now wear the stains
That came from that girl’s cheek
